Analysis

The most recent figure for land-use change — emissions (co2eq) from ch4 in Sri Lanka is 0 kt, measured in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 34 years on record.

Over the whole period, land-use change — emissions (co2eq) from ch4 in Sri Lanka peaked at 42.34 kt in 1999 and was at its lowest, 0 kt, in 2001.

That places Sri Lanka 66th out of 218 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
